Sheraton Hotel im Flughafen Charles-de-Gaulle, Paris/Partition Walls A semitransparent partition screen made of stainless steel mesh `Omega 1520` was installed in the conference centre of the Sheraton Hotel. This screen is 24 m long and 2.35 m high. If one looks straight through the mesh, it is still rather transparent. If one changes the angle of view, the mesh becomes increasingly opaque. It is stable enough to be fitted in a frame without any further support. Andrée Putman

Kirche `Notre Dame de l `Arche de l`Alliance`, Paris/Partition Walls Along the rear wall in the chancel of the church a noble and worthy atmosphere was created with stainless steel mesh type `Omega 1550`. So as to further liven up the atmosphere, a pipe is covered with the gently curved mesh panels, where by the textile character of the mesh is stressed. Architecture Studio

Museum für Kunst und Gewerbe, Hamburg/Facade claddings The facade of the new building next to the neo-renaissance building is clad with stainless steel mesh `Omega 1520`. The material is translucent and yet it appears as though it were a closed surface. Störmer: `The structural reduction of the new facade to a translucent surface transforms it into a screen dividing the court yard.` Alsop & Stoermer

UGC-Kino, Paris-Bercy/Facade claddings The detailed photograph shows a distance holder integrated into the fabric which prevents the fabric `Omega 1520` from smashing against the facade due to heavy wind loads. A solution which is both simple, functional and decorative. The cutting of the metallic fabric does not have any influence on its stability. Valode & Pistre

Universität Genève, On-Off/Facade claddings This university building is wrapped by 1285 m² Omega 1520 forming a transparent sun shading. Panels are approx. 23 m high and approx. 7,30 m wide. Meyer & Bouvier, Genève

Museum für Kunst und Gewerbe, Hamburg/Facade claddings The mesh is mounted on the facade in a one-piece continuous web. The material is installed on a substructure and attached with tension springs. Owing to the monochrome flat surface of the mesh the surface is seemingly uninterrupted - the building acquires its individual appearance. Alsop & Stoermer

Bibliothèque National de France, Paris/Sun screening elements Large sun shade elements in the inner courts of the Library increase the reading comfort. The metallic fabric `Omega 1520` has been inserted into frames which can be shifted according to the position of the sun. According to the required light absorption a suitable mesh type is selected. `Omega` allows different densities in one mesh element. Dominique Perrault
